## Changelog — Ticktrace 1.9

### Renamed: DRIFT_API_TOKEN
During the cron drift investigation we found plugins confusing this variable with the metrics token, so it has been renamed to indicate it authorizes drift-report uploads specifically. Plugin authors must read the new name from 1.9 onward; the old name is ignored without warning. Sample env files in the SDK are updated. In your deployment env file, the drift-report upload secret is set on the next line.

env line for fawef-taguf: VAULT_KEY13=a9695905a9a90

The Tallgrass billing service caches tax-rate lookups from the upstream Ratewell provider for 24 hours. Entries are keyed by jurisdiction code; no customer data is stored in the cache. Invalidation happens on provider webhook or manual flush. Cache contents are readable by any service in the billing namespace, which is the main review concern. The access matrix and threat notes are on the page below.

wiki page, tahaf-tajog: https://jira.ordindyn.corp/pipeline

## Ownership

The clock-skew monitor for the Quarrylight build farm lives in this repo. Build agents occasionally drift more than the 250ms tolerance, which breaks artifact timestamp ordering and causes the Slatebird scheduler to mark runs as flaky. If support sees skew alerts, first check the NTP sidecar logs, then escalate rather than restarting agents manually — restarts mask the drift without fixing it. Questions about the monitor, its thresholds, or the escalation path go to the component owner listed below.

account owner for kagag-yahap: Novath Quenok

Handover Note — Incoming Director, Branwick Logistics

Insurance renewal is the first priority. Current fleet and liability cover with Ternhall Mutual lapses at month end. Quotes are in from two alternatives; Ternhall's revised premium is up 9%, others higher but with broader cargo terms. Claims history is clean except the Dunmere depot incident, now settled. Decision needed within ten days — broker is waiting on you. The confidential note on forward plans sits directly below this line.

confidential, baweg-tahop: The steering committee signed off on a budget of $1.4 million for Project Gordor. The renewal with Elioxix Holdings closes at $31.7 million a year, 60 percent below the last contract.